Graham Rowntree sounded devastated in his post-game TV interview after Munster had been dethroned as United Rugby Championship champions. The Irish facet had been closely tipped to qualify for the ultimate and host the Bulls subsequent Saturday in Limerick.

Nonetheless, their ambition to win back-to-back league titles for the primary time got here a cropper as Glasgow pulled off the 17-10 ambush at Thomond Park that now has them heading to South Africa to play within the decider.  

Regardless of dominating first-half possession and territory, Munster trailed 7-3 on the interval and so they went on to seek out themselves 14-3 behind on 50 minutes though the Warriors had been twice yellow carded by that stage.

Rowntree’s facet finally minimize the margin with a transformed Antoine Frisch attempt however a crimson card for Alex Nankivell, which resulted in George Horne’s 74th-minute penalty kick, settled the result in favour of the Warriors.

“Christ, that’s going to sting for some time, I’m not going to mislead you,” fumed Rowntree post-game.  “You’ve got to take your possibilities on this sport. Merciless. Didn’t take our possibilities first half with all that territory and possession after which they received that unfastened attempt.

“The second half was a equally trying attempt for them. We received down close to their line and we weren’t correct sufficient and we had been attempting to pressure issues an excessive amount of.

“We’ll have a look at ourselves. I’m immensely pleased with the place we completed this 12 months. We topped the league, we earned ourselves a house semi-final. However that’s sport, you recognize, it’s merciless. They took their possibilities higher than us.  

“The long run is shiny the blokes we’ve received coming by way of. There are a couple of guys transferring on who deserved higher than what we gave them tonight however that’s sport. They’ll transfer on, we’ll transfer on. That is going to sting and rightly so for a very long time. You get your self a house semi-final after which to not get the job executed, that’s going to sting. However we’ve to stay with that.”

Munster legend David Wallace claimed that current workmanlike performances in the end haunted Rowntree’s fees. Talking on Premier Sports activities, he mentioned: “It’s actually robust for him and what an incredible season they’ve had. In November they had been eleventh within the league after which they got here again and completed prime. To get to the knockout levels and simply not hearth on all cylinders is actually arduous.

“From the teaching perspective, they had been in all probability doing all the proper issues and in the end perhaps the gamers catching a ball, I imply you may’t coach for that when it will get to this stage of the season.

“Are the gamers going to go on the market and pull the set off and be decisive and scientific relating to it? For the teaching employees, you’re feeling a bit sorry for them however typically that occurs.

“Munster misplaced somewhat little bit of momentum coming into the top of the season and simply too many errors crept in. We perhaps glossed over it somewhat bit, they glossed over it being somewhat workmanlike in these video games, getting the wins however in the end they should be placing within the huge performances as nicely to actually knock out these huge groups.”
